Snug within a quiet residential community, Highland Park Elementary has been teaching children in pre-kindergarten through sixth grade as part of the Gilbert Public Schools District since 2006. At this A+ School of Excellence, young minds can thrive in all areas with a philosophy that infuses social and emotional learning to help students become more confident and secure well-rounded individuals. Through a rigorous curriculum, students at Highland Park earn test scores in reading and math that are significantly above the district and state averages, often helping the school to rank in the top 15% of elementary schools in Arizona. Here, advanced students can participate in an accelerated learning program where they can learn concepts that are one grade level ahead of their peers. Anyone can develop musical skills in band, strings or music, or share their talents in performances for each grade level. Outside of the classroom, students can also participate in a wide range of enrichment activities including chess, dance, music, science, LEGO engineering, Kinder Robotics, Young Rembrandts and beginners sports training, among others offered seasonally. Highland Park also integrates field trips at every grade level and gives students plenty of opportunities to shine in front of the community at school musicals or special events throughout the year.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data.
